Apprenticeship in Design:
Having an apprenticeship in design is always a good step to becoming a designer, because you are learning and earning. You will be learning from someone one to one on different things needed for design or maybe in a team. Even though you are earning whilst learning the pay isnt great, you start on £2.60 an hour and it stays as low as this for a year then you go to the minimum wage. Also its only on a temporary basis they may not keep you on after the apprenticeships finished but you work on the basis that they might.

Internship:
An internship is good for experiance to put on your C.V to take to a place of work, but you will be working for free you dont get paid for this. So you need to be very commited and know what you want because it will be just like having a normal job just without pay. This is also temporary, depending on how long the probabtion period is, so they may only keep you for a couple of week.

Assistants:
Working as a design assistant usually means you are on salaried pay, which is better than the apprentice one but still only a minimum wage. This will always be a perminent depending on the probation period which could be two weeks or longer after this period it should be permanent. Just like the Apprenticeship and Internship you will be getting experiance and learning on the job.

Key Job Roles:
Creative Designer Jobs - These jobs are for the more creative graphic designers, they apply a greater importance on the ability to generate highly developed creative concepts. Jobs like this are found in agencies where there are normally three designers.

Illustrators - Illustrators provide illustrations for a variety of jobs such as computer games, magazines, cartoons, adverts even clothing. Normally illustrators are freelance or work for really big agencies.

Web Designers - Web designers have the ability to design websites, their normally very creative individuals with a good knowledge of programming skills. Flash, video or mulitmedia designers all fit into this category.

3D Designers - 3D Designers are very higly skilled in using 3D programmes to produce visually accurate presentations and animations of 3D characters, products or even house viewings or buildings plans.

Factors that may have an impact on the design industry:
Globalisation - This is where designers can have contact with other designers and companies from across the world due to tecgnology and software such as e-mail, internet. This makes it easy because you can send PDF's and proofing of work from one side of the world to another in a matter of seconds. Also you can always find cheaper work in other parts of country so it may mean making more money on materials and manufacturing of products may be cheaper.

New Technology - Designers need to keep up to date with new technology such as new designing software because if they dont some new designer could come along with the new software or better software and be able to produce a final product quicker so they might lose work due to older technology. Also due to new things on the internet such as 'VistaPrint' its a lot easier and quicker to make things such as business cards. This will always be a competition for designers.

Convergence - This is the merge of distinct technologies into a new form, maybe requiring new software or a new look. These sort of things are smart phones such as android or iphone they constantly need updating by designers to beat the competiton. Also with the social networking websites becoming a bigger hit everyday web designers will constantly have to be designing new things for it.
